The Manufacturing Process
Manufacturing waterproof body bags involves several meticulous steps to ensure durability and effectiveness. The process starts with selecting appropriate materials, often consisting of high-quality synthetic fabrics such as Nylon or PVC. These materials are chosen for their lightweight yet sturdy characteristics, as well as their resistance to water.
Once the materials are sourced, the cutting phase begins. Precision is key to ensure that each bag will be functional and fit for purpose. After the fabrics are cut, they undergo a sealing process where seams are welded rather than stitched. This method is critical, as stitched seams can allow water to seep through. Heat sealing or ultrasonic welding techniques are commonly employed to create a hermetic seal that provides optimal waterproof characteristics.
Quality control is integral to the manufacturing process. Each bag undergoes rigorous testing to ascertain that it meets the required standards for waterproofness. Factories often use simulated water exposure tests to check for leaks and assess overall durability.
